Right -- re-connecting (e.g., via "service netif restart wlan0") should
be starting "dhclient wlan0".

Because I (also) needed to re-populate my ipfw rules when I get a new
DHCP lease, I cobbled up a /etc/dhclient-exit-hooks script; while I was
there anyway, I put in some code at that point to make /etc/resolv.conf
"sane" (by whatever passes for my standards).
